FAIRBANKS, Alaska – The Alaska Nanooks Nordic ski team will hit the road to Bozeman, Montana this weekend for the RMISA Championships.

Last Time Out
The Nanooks Nordic ski team last competed at the Utah Invitational in Salt Lake City, Utah on Feb. 14 and Feb. 15. While it was not the best showing for the Nanooks as a team, it still held strong races out of certain individuals. On day one,
Mariel Pulles and
Tristan Sayre led the way for the 'Nooks as the top finishers in the women's and men's races. On day two, Pulles led the way again for the women's team while
Christopher Kalev led the way for the Nanooks.
Full Team
The Nanooks will look to qualify a full team to the NCAA Championships this weekend. With five tickets punched to the postseason, the 'Nooks are in search of a third female qualifier to be able to compete in the team category.
Racers
On the women's side of the race,
Sarah Olson,
Catherine Reed-Metayer,
Sage Robine,
Anja Maijala, Rya Berrigan and Hannah Deuling will compete in a 5km skate on Friday, Feb. 28 and will race in a 15km classic race on Saturday, Feb. 29.
On the men's side,
Logan Mowry,
Tristan Sayre,
Lukash Platil,
Christopher Kalev,
Karl Danielson and
Mike Ophoff will be competing in a 10km skate on Friday the 28th and a 20km classic race on Saturday the 29th.
